Today’s guest has been doing amazing work in this areas alongside
Peter Senge, Daniel Goleman and colleagues at the IB, through the
Center for Systems Awareness at MIT. Dr Mette Miriam Böll is the
is the Co-founder and Executive Director of the centre, as well
as the co-founded of The MIT Systems Awareness Lab with Peter
Senge.
Her academic background is as a biologist specialized in the
evolution of complex social systems, mammalian play behavior and
philosophy of nature. Mette has a Ph.D. in organizational
ethology and holds additional degrees in contemplative leadership
and the philosophy and history of science.
She uses her training in these diverse areas to research how
emotions and feelings are transmitted in social relations and how
the resulting relational fields in turn shape the larger systems
human beings are parts of, with a particular focus on education.
Mette previously held a position as head of research at Metropol
University College, a teachers’ college in Copenhagen and before
that she taught neuroscience of emotions.
